Jupp Heynckes reveals that he is currently considering an offer to manage Bayern Munich for a fourth time.

Jupp Heynckes has suggested that he is yet to decide whether to accept an offer to manage Bayern Munich for a fourth time in his career.

Last week, Carlo Ancelotti was removed from his position as boss of the Bundesliga outfit after a poor start to the campaign, and it led to the likes of Thomas Tuchel, Julian Nagelsmann, Louis van Gaal and Luis Enrique all being linked with a switch to the Allianz Arena.

However, reports emerged on Thursday that Heynckes - who last managed Bayern in 2013 - had been offered the chance to return to the club, and the veteran has confirmed that the speculation is true.

The 72-year-old told RPOnline: "It's not clear yet or signed. I have to analyse the whole thing first. Four and a half years have passed since I left Bavaria, and football has changed."

Heynckes ended his last reign at Bayern by guiding the club to the Champions League with victory over rivals Borussia Dortmund.
